Angles Problem Solving Answer Key and Explanations

To find the missing measurement in a geometric figure, first determine what relationships exist between the components. For example, in triangles, the sum of all interior angles equals 180°. If two angles are known, the third can be calculated by subtracting the sum of the known angles from 180°.
